    To avoid this scenario, we recommend keeping collected sales tax funds in a separate bank account. Then when sales tax funds are due to the states, they come to find that they don’t have the cash to pay…yeah, not the situation you want to be in. When you collect sales tax from a customer, you now have a liability to the state for those collected funds. When you collect sales tax, you are now holding money that doesn’t belong to you, which is why you should record it as a liability when you collect it. Keep in mind that sales tax is neither income nor an expense to your business. Let’s talk about the least sexy part of running a business…sales tax.

    Remember, the credit terms (or terms) provides information to the buyer about when the invoice is due and if there is a discount allowed for paying the invoice early. However, because the amount of sales returns and sales allowances is useful information to management, it should be shown separately. Smith Company paid $100 cash on May 4 for shipping on the May 4 sale to Hanlon Food Store. In the May 21 sale, the shipping terms FOB Shipping Point means the buyer is responsible and the seller will not record anything for shipping. As the seller, we will record any shipping costs in the Delivery Expense account as a debit. But, we must also match the revenue and expenses incurred (remember the matching principle?) and we will record the expense cost of goods sold.
